HWSW Informatikai Kerekasztal: LPT1 port átirányítása fájlba - HWSW Informatikai Kerekasztal

Ugrás a tartalomhoz

Mellékleteink: HUP | Gamekapocs

Oldal 1 / 1
  • Nem indíthatsz témát.
  • A téma zárva.

LPT1 port átirányítása fájlba

#1 Felhasználó inaktív   biglaci 

  • Törzsvendég
  • Pip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 852
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 11:16

Sziasztok!

Fogalmam sincs igazából hol kellett volna ezt a topikot nyitnom. Ha nem itt, akkor kérnék egy modot, hogy a megfelelő helyre tegye át.

A téma:

Adott egy dos-os program, ami kizárólag LPT1 portra nyomtat. Az operációs rendszer Win2000. A nyomtató nem támogatja a DOS-t.
A feladat az lenne, hogy egy olyan nyomtatóra kell nyomtatnunk, aminek nincs LPT1 portja és a DOS-t sem támogatja, tehát a net use lpt1 kiesett. Valahogy nem ugrik be az a módszer, amivel az LPT1 portra küldött nyomtatásokat egy adott mappa, adott néven történő fájlba írja.
Tehát a kérdésem az lenne: hogyan lehet beállíani, hogy az lpt1 portra küldött DOS alapú nyomtatás mondjuk a c:\valami\nyomi.txt fájlba kerüljön, úgy hogy a programot nem lehet megbolygatni?

A létrejött txt fájlt már windows nyomtatóra lehet küldeni, ahhoz az eszköz megvan, csak valahogy létre kell jönnie a fájlnak. :)


Előre is köszi!

Szerkesztette: biglaci 2007. 11. 07. 11:17 -kor


#2 Felhasználó inaktív   lordrolee 

  • Senior tag
  • PipaPip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 2.908
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 11:34

Próbálkozz ezzel: http://dosprn.ks.ua/
Kép

Xfire profil

LordRolee

#3 Felhasználó inaktív   biglaci 

  • Törzsvendég
  • Pip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 852
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 11:43

Ez sajnos fizetős. Teljes egészében ingyenes megoldás kell. A lényeg, hogy fájlba kerüljön ami az LPT1-re kerül. A többi már megoldott.
Sajnos nyomtató létrehozása :file porttal nem jó, mert rákérdez a fájl nevére.

#4 Felhasználó inaktív   PetruZ 

  • Törzsvendég
  • Pip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 1.294
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 11:59

Nyomtató hozzáadása - helyi - port: LPT1 - típus: Generic / Text (magyarban: Általános / Szöveg). Nem erre gondolsz?
/ Gigabyte H67M-UDH2-B3, Core2 i5-2300@2.8, 2x2GB A-Data DDR3/PC1333 Gaming, Asus HD6870/1GB, Samsung 1TB/SATA2 + HD200HJ, LG SATA dvd-rw, Asus TA-B71 + FSP Saga II 500W, Samsung 215TW, Sweex optikai/USB, noname bill.

#5 Felhasználó inaktív   biglaci 

  • Törzsvendég
  • Pip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 852
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 12:20

Idézet: PetruZ - Dátum: 2007. nov. 7., szerda - 12:59

Nyomtató hozzáadása - helyi - port: LPT1 - típus: Generic / Text (magyarban: Általános / Szöveg). Nem erre gondolsz?

Sajnos nem. :( Ez nem fájlba nyomtat, hanem az lpt1 portra, ahol kézileg tudok beállítani dolgokat.

#6 Felhasználó inaktív   PetruZ 

  • Törzsvendég
  • Pip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 1.294
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 12:52

Akkor gugli, pár perc és prn2file. :)
/ Gigabyte H67M-UDH2-B3, Core2 i5-2300@2.8, 2x2GB A-Data DDR3/PC1333 Gaming, Asus HD6870/1GB, Samsung 1TB/SATA2 + HD200HJ, LG SATA dvd-rw, Asus TA-B71 + FSP Saga II 500W, Samsung 215TW, Sweex optikai/USB, noname bill.

#7 Felhasználó inaktív   Szabcsi 

  • Őstag
  • PipaPipaPip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 7.582
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 12:54

PRN2FILE.COM egy helyen ilyet láttam erre a célra... (nem tudom hogy ingyenes-e)
"A gugliban rákeresve porcos hal is és emlős is."/"Megoldás: keress rá a hal.dll fájlra, és töröld ki, majd indítsd újra a gépedet. Utána jó lesz!"/"mutasd meg a gyakorlatban ezt a technológiát és esküszöm dollármilliárdost csinálok belőled ! "/"Rakjunk egy jo kib@szottnagy KERESS gombot a kepernyo kozepere es csumi"

#8 Felhasználó inaktív   Root_Kiskacsa 

  • Senior tag
  • PipaPip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 3.379
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 21:12

Bár kőbaltás a módszer, de működik.
A nyomtatásra váró spooler fájlokat a Windows egy mappába gyűjti és onnan tolja ki őket a nyomtatóra. Ez igaz akkor is, ha DOS-ból nyomtatsz egy net use-os lpt portra. Azaz meg tudod tenni, hogy feltelepítesz egy kamu nyomtatót, aztán DOS-ból az lpt1-et átirányítod rá. Innentől kezdve amit a DOS-os program ki próbál nyomtatni, megtalálod fájlként a spoolerben, ami alapértelmezés szerint a C:\WINDOWS\System32\spool\PRINTERS mappa. Miután onnan kimentetted, a kamu nyomtató nyomtatási sorából törölheted.
Persze ez inkább workaround, mintsem tartós megoldás.
Pen-drive-on, notebookon, PDA-n kizárólag máshonnan reprodukálható/visszamásolható adat legyen!
Ami hordozható, az nem megbízható!

#9 Felhasználó inaktív   charlie 

  • Őstag
  • PipaPipaPip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 14.481
  • Csatlakozott: --

Elküldve: 2007. 11. 07. 21:22

és egy pdf nyomtato felrakasa lpt1-re?
MikroVPS | Xen VPS | OpenVZ VPS | SSD VPS

#10 Felhasználó inaktív   negyvenketto 

  • Törzsvendég
  • Pip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 1.175
  • Csatlakozott: --

Elküldve: 2007. 11. 08. 09:05

itt volt hasonló témaféleség
Az élet a világmindenség meg minden...

Hivatásos topicsüllyesztő...

#11 Felhasználó inaktív   biglaci 

  • Törzsvendég
  • PipaPipaPipa
  • Csoport: Fórumtag
  • Hozzászólások: 852
  • Csatlakozott: --

Elküldve: 2007. 11. 08. 14:41

Hát a gugli megvolt és nem pár percben.:) De meglett a megoldás. Ez a prn2file.com 1988-as assemblyben írt program. És működik.:) Közben kaptam egy másik 4 kb-os kis szintén nagyon régi programot és az is szépen átirányítja az lpt1 portot fájlba. p2f.com a program neve.
Most már megvannak a kimenetek és szépen megcsinálom rá a programot, ami a vezérlőjeleket "konvertálja" és mehet is a nyomtatóra.
Köszi a segítséget!

Téma megosztása:


Oldal 1 / 1
  • Nem indíthatsz témát.
  • A téma zárva.

1 felhasználó olvassa ezt a témát.
0 felhasználó, 1 vendég, 0 anonim felhasználó